Christmas Petits Fours

December 20, 2011 by Meaghan Mountford

For a last minute Christmas treat idea, wrap Oreo Cakesters in fondant and pipe designs on top with royal icing. I have more detailed how-tos over at my blog. These Christmas petits fours are straight from the pages of my book out early next year, Sugarlicious. Find a pdf of the directions HERE.

Sugar and Glass

December 20, 2011 by Meaghan Mountford

One more check on the list for the legitimacy of sugar as an artistic medium. Apparently sugar is an oft-used tool for glassblowers when creating prototypes for future glass designs.
